Deontay Wilder's comeback fight takes place in New York. Devin Haney's rematch against George Kambosos Jr is taking place also in Melbourne. In London, Claressa Shields and Savannah Marshall fight for the undisputed women's middleweight titles at The O2 arena. Mikaela Mayer and Alycia Baumgardner meet for unified women’s super-featherweight title.

Claressa Shields fights Savannah Marshall tonight at 7 pm on Sky Sports. Ring walks for the co-main event between Mayer and Baumgardner will take place at 9 pm. The ring walks between Shields and Marshall will probably start at 10 pm for this fight.

Claressa Shields vs Savannah Marshall will be broadcast live on Sky Sports Main Event and Sky Sport Arena. ESPN+ will broadcast the fight in the US. Sky Go subscribers can watch the live stream via their mobile, tablet and smart TV devices.

Claressa Shields vs Savannah Marshall for undisputed women's middleweight titles. Mikaela Mayer vs Alycia Baumgardner for unified women’s super-featherweight title. Lauren Price vs Timea Belik, Karris Artingstall vs Marina Sakharov, Caroline Dubois vs Milena Koleva, Ebonie Jones vs Vanessa Caballero, April Hunter vs Erica Alvarez, Georgia O'Connor vs Joyce van Ee, Shannon Ryan vs Bucha El Quassi, Ginny Fuchs vs Gemma Ruegg and Sarah Liegmann vs Bec Connolly on the undercard.

Deontay Wilder's comeback fight against Robert Helenius is likely to start around 4 am UK time on Sunday morning.

Deontay Wilder vs Robert Helenius will be broadcast live on FITE TV. The event will cost UK fans £12.99. You can live stream the fight card on the Fite TV app.

Devin Haney vs George Kambosos Jr 2 is scheduled for 3:30 am on Sunday morning in the UK.

Devin Haney vs George Kambosos Jr 2 will be broadcast on Foxtel PPV in Australia and on ESPN in the U.S. Sky Sports subscribers can watch the fight via the Sky Go app on their mobile, tablet and smart TV devices.

Devin Haney fights George Kambosos Jr for Haneys' lightweight titles. Jason Moloney fights Nawaphon Kaikanha. Andrew Molony fights Norbelto Jimenez. Cherneka Johnson fights Susie Ramadan.
